Job Summary

The Director of Financial Aid and Scholarships at Portland State University is responsible for the overall management of the Student Financial Aid and Scholarships office. This includes funds management, Federal, State, and local reporting, policy development and analysis, scholarship administration, compliance oversight, and processing operations. The Director will direct administration and compliance of $220 million on an annual basis in federal, state, and institutional aid and scholarships.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ead a team of 23 staff and 10-15 student employees in the Student Financial Aid and Scholarships office.
  • Develop and implement policies and procedures for financial aid and scholarship administration.
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and institutional regulations and guidelines.
  • Manage the office's annual operating budget of $2.1 million.
  • Collaborate with Enrollment Management Leadership Team, colleges/schools, athletics, advancement, and other departments to promote student success and a positive public relations image for Portland State University.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ree from a regionally accredited institution.
  • Three to five years of successful experience in Financial Aid at the Director or Associate Director level.
  • Demonstrated leadership of a diverse unit of financial aid and scholarship professionals.
  • Prior responsibility for audit management, program certification, and ensuring compliance.
  • Experience with automated disbursement and tracking through Financial Aid software and knowledge of current applications.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Master's or doctoral degree preferred.
  • Financial Aid leveraging and modeling experience.
  • Scholarship administration experience.
  • Ellucian Banner experience preferred.
